According to sources, Enzo Maresca’s side is very interested in Brighton midfielder Carlos Baleba and is keeping a close eye on him for a summer transfer.
According to sources, Chelsea contacted Brighton earlier in January to inquire about Baleba’s availability and transfer valuation.
Chelsea has little chance of signing Balela before the February 3 deadline without significantly overpaying for his services.
However, this is not beyond the Chelsea board, which has demonstrated a willingness to spend large sums when focused on a specific goal.
The Blues board had already done this with Brighton, when they approved Moises Caciedo’s British record £115 million (add-ons included) deal.
Baleba would expect a huge sum, and Brighton place a high value on the 21-year-old, with insiders believing he has more to give offensively and all-around than the more defensively inclined Caicedo.
Chelsea are not alone in their interest in Baleba, with considerable interest growing in Italy, as well as throughout Europe.
Baleba’s contract runs until the summer of 2028, with a club option for an additional year included in the conditions.
That puts Brighton in a very strong position, and as we have seen before, they are not easily swayed from the high valuations they place on their players.
